DESCRIPTION:
Gnu’s best-selling line is now Sandwich! Proven Mervin construction, low-maintenance CX2500 base material, rugged UHMW sidewalls, easy-to-ride bi-axial glassweaves, vertically laminiated aspen core, and radial sidecuts on twin shapes make pro model performance available at a great price. The "Carbon High Beam Wides" fit bigger feet.
